Axiom 1.2.13 [Was: Axis2 1.6.2 release plan]

Axiom currently builds a patched version of the maven-shade-plugin to
work around MSHADE-105. If we release Axiom, then we also release that
patched version into Maven central (of course with a different
groupId/artifactId). Looking at the recent discussion between SOLR and
Commons CSV, this may become a political issue, although the problem
is slightly different here because in the case of a patched version of
a Maven plugin, there is no possibility for an accidental conflict.

Fortunately, we have a maintainer of the maven-shade-plugin in the PMC.

Benson, can we please get your opinion on that question?
